Jagan-CBIFor the first time in the YS Viveka murder case, the CBI listed Jagan’s name. Jagan’s name was featured in the additional counter filed by the CBI in the Viveka murder case.

The CBI stated that Jagan knew about Viveka’s murder even before the latter’s PA, Krishna Reddy announced to the media.
